Transaction

6d6a87c69aacf76d776d2e2cfc0ff8a63febce4aeedee2175fec9f46e68a1356
268,975 confirmations
Timestamp
1610672877
Block666,099
Fee27,604 sats
Fee rate134.7 sats/vB
view on mempool.space

Inputs & Outputs